Resolution is defining the point distance which the scanner is capturing. The smaller the distance, the higher the resolution, and more density points of the data for better detail.If you select low resolution, the point distance is bigger, less points generated. We suggest to set low resolution when scan large size object for better scanning experience. As the leading drafting party of the industry standard of "Chinese Structure light 3D measurement system", SHINING 3D has always been serious about accuracy. Unlike "single frame accuracy", we tend to test "accuracy of aligned data" in a professional measurement way. Because 3D models are usually stitched together from multiple scanned frames, in most cases the accuracy one is discussing is not the highest accuracy that can be obtained from a single scan. It comes with a two-in-one cable just like on more professional 3D scanners; the power cable plugs into the data cable, which is plugged into the scanner. Calibration EXStar prompts you to hold the scanner at different distances and angles from the plate. If you are new to 3D scanner calibration processes, you might need to get the hang of some of the angles. Make sure you follow the same movement shown on the software interface.It’s also amazing that you can edit your mesh directly within EXStar. On most other low-cost 3D scanners, you’d have to install and use a second software that may or may not be from the manufacturer. This means additional export steps, getting to know another software and UX if it’s not from the same editor, etc. In short, a hassle.
